More about community recreation courses in South Australia
If you are looking to enhance your skills in the Community Recreation field in South Australia, you are in the right place. The state offers a variety of courses designed to cater to different experience levels, whether you are a beginner or an advanced learner. Some popular beginner courses include the Certificate III in Fitness SIS30321, the Certificate III in Sport, Aquatics and Recreation SIS30122, and essential first aid certifications such as Provide First Aid HLTAID011 and Provide Basic Emergency Life Support HLTAID010. These foundational courses are perfect for those looking to enter the recreation industry with no prior qualifications.
For those with prior experience, South Australia also offers advanced courses that can help you elevate your career in community recreation. Consider pursuing a Bachelor of Business (Sport Management) or a Certificate IV in Sport, Aquatics and Recreation SIS40122, which are tailored for individuals looking to make a significant impact in the field. The Certificate IV in Sport Development SIS40421 also offers specialised knowledge for those keen on advancing their careers in sport management.
